Understanding the optimal timing for roofing service is essential for ensuring quality work and long-lasting results. Weather conditions, temperature, and seasonal factors influence the effectiveness and durability of roofing projects.

Spring Roofing Service

Spring offers moderate temperatures and longer daylight hours, making it a popular choice for roofing projects. It minimizes delays caused by harsh weather.

Summer Roofing Service

Summer provides warm weather, ideal for certain roofing materials. However, high temperatures can pose challenges for installation and curing processes.

Fall Roofing Service

Fall is often considered optimal due to cooler temperatures and dry conditions, reducing the risk of weather-related delays.

Winter Roofing Service

Winter is generally less suitable due to cold temperatures and potential snow or ice, which can hinder roofing work and affect material performance.

Roofing services encompass a variety of tasks including repairs, replacements, and inspections. Proper timing ensures that materials are installed under conditions that prevent issues such as leaks, warping, or premature deterioration. For example, asphalt shingles adhere best when temperatures are above 45°F, and roofing materials cure properly in dry, warm conditions. Seasonal considerations also impact project scheduling, with spring and fall generally offering the most favorable weather for roofing work.

Statistics indicate that scheduling roofing projects during optimal seasons can reduce the likelihood of delays by up to 30%. Additionally, weather-related damage claims decrease significantly when work is performed during suitable weather windows. Proper timing not only enhances the quality of the installation but also extends the lifespan of the roofing system.
